Stack Overflow论坛网址
时间: 2023-08-10 16:06:28 浏览: 54
Stack Overflow 是一个非常知名的程序员问答社区,你可以在那里提问和回答关于编程的问题。你可以访问以下网址进入 Stack Overflow 论坛:
https://stackoverflow.com/
在 Stack Overflow 上,你可以搜索已有的问题和答案,或者向社区发布自己的问题并等待其他开发者的回答。这是一个非常有用的资源,希望能对你有所帮助!
相关问题
stack overflow
栈溢出(Stack Overflow)是指程序在使用栈空间时,无法分配到足够的内存空间,导致栈溢出的错误。栈是一种内存空间,用于存储程序执行过程中的函数调用、变量、参数等信息。当函数调用结束时,栈中的数据会被弹出,栈顶指针会移回上一个函数的位置。
当程序中某个函数调用层级过多、函数内部使用大量的局部变量、函数参数过多等情况下,会导致栈空间不足,从而发生栈溢出。栈溢出会导致程序崩溃、数据丢失等问题,是一个常见的程序错误。
为了避免栈溢出问题,可以采取以下措施:
1. 减少函数调用层级,尽量避免嵌套过深的函数调用。
2. 减少局部变量的使用,避免在函数内部定义过多的局部变量。
3. 减少函数参数的数量,避免在函数调用时传递过多的参数。
4. 使用动态分配内存的方式,如使用堆空间代替栈空间,避免在栈空间中存储大量数据。
5. 对于递归函数,需要限制递归深度,避免无限递归导致栈溢出。
总之,栈溢出是一种常见的程序错误,对程序的稳定性和安全性都有很大的影响,需要在编写程序时充分考虑并避免发生。
Stack Overflow 和 csdn
Stack Overflow 和 CSDN 都是IT技术领域的知名社区和学习交流平台。
Stack Overflow 是全球最大的技术问答社区,用户可以在Stack Overflow上提出问题并得到回答,也可以回答其他用户的问题。Stack Overflow 的主要特点是问题和答案都可以被社区中其他用户编辑和完善,从而不断提高问题和答案的质量和准确性。
CSDN 则是中国最大的IT技术社区和开发者社区,提供了丰富的技术文章、博客、问答、课程、下载等服务,为中国的IT技术人员提供了一个优质的学习交流平台。CSDN 上的内容主要以中文为主,而 Stack Overflow 则主要以英文为主。
总体来说,Stack Overflow 更加注重问题和答案的质量和准确性,而 CSDN 则更加注重与中国本土的 IT 技术相关的内容和服务。两者都是IT技术人员非常重要的学习和交流平台。